Mitchell V's 848whp 6466 2.0 E85 Highway monster

Mitchell had one goal, something that would be fun on the interstate. When he bought the car originally, it had a 2.3 and 5862. That made reasonable power but was not a well balanced combo and soon ended up on the chopping block.

FFWD-

English Racing 2.0
English Racing Bushmaster race port head
Wiseco 9:1
R&R 150mm rods
Magnus V5
GSC +1mm valves
GSC S3 camshafts
GSC valvesprings
Fuel Injector Clinic 2150cc Hi-z injectors
Buschur Double pumper kit
Custom forward facing turbo kit
ETS 4" intercooler
Precision 6466 Gen 2
Omnipower 4 bar
SD tune

It is out of pump and on stock lines so once that is resolved I feel there is more left to go. Please note the RPM pickup fouled up, the torque is actually 594 peak right before that weird spike.
